7.7 Viewing Real-Time Data With Profinia Software

To collect real-time data:

1. Connect the USB cable provided with the Profinia software package to the USB port on

the back of the instrument and to the computer.

Important: The front USB port does not output real-time data.

2. Open Profinia software on your computer by double-clicking on the desktop Profinia

software icon. Look for the connection icon in the Profinia software in the lower left
corner of the software screen (see section 12 for more information on using Profinia
software.

At this point, the run can be started and the chromatogram displays on the computer
screen.

7.8 Starting the Run

The Start Run screen (Figure 7.13) displays a summary of the sample information. It also
displays a reminder to connect the instrument to a computer running Profinia software if
you would like to view the chromatogram in real time. The Profinia system does not require
software and a computer to operate the instrument; current data points appear on the
running screen.

The lower toolbar contains buttons for viewing the methods steps and for optional manual
priming of any extra tubing attached to the sample, buffer, diluent, or waste lines to
accommodate larger containers in these ports.

Note: Touching the Home button returns the user directly to the home screen and all the
run and sample information resets, except the lot number tracking information. A saved
method remains stored in memory. An edited method that is not saved reverts to the original
settings.
